(a) A contracting entity shall not: 
(1) Offer to a healthcare provider a healthcare contract that includes a most favored nation clause; 
(2) Enter into a healthcare contract with a healthcare provider that includes a most favored nation clause; or 
(3) Amend or renew an existing healthcare contract previously entered into with a healthcare provider so that the contract as amended or renewed adds or continues to include a most favored nation clause. 
(b) 
(1) A violation of this section is: 
(A) An unfair trade practice under § 23-66-206; and 
(B) Subject to the Trade Practices Act, § 23-66-201 et seq. 
(2) If a healthcare contract contains a provision that violates this section, the healthcare contract is void.
